RUST: Joel Souza’s Western Actioner Adds Travis Fimmel And More For October Shoot

Highland Film Group is announcing cast for Crown Vic helmer Joel Souza’s new Western, Rust, following the attachment of Academy Award nominee and Golden Globe Award winner Alec Baldwin (Mission: Impossible franchise, NBC’s “30 Rock”) last year. Principal photography will commence come early October in New Mexico with Baldwin joined by Travis Fimmel (Ridley Scott’s “Raised by Wolves,” Universal Pictures’ Warcraft, Amazon’s “Vikings”), Brady Noon (Universal Pictures’ Good Boys, Disney +’s “The Mighty Ducks: Game Changer”) and Frances Fisher (Titanic, Warner Bros.’ Unforgiven)

Rust is an action/western which tells of infamous Western outlaw Harland Rust (Baldwin), who’s had a bounty on his head for as long as he can remember. When his estranged 13-year-old grandson Lucas is convicted of an accidental murder and is sentenced to hang, Rust travels to Kansas to break him out of prison. Together, the two fugitives must outrun legendary U.S. Marshal, Wood Helm, and bounty-hunter, Fenton “Preacher” Lang, who are hot on their tail. Deeply buried secrets rise from the ashes and an unexpected familial bond begins to form as the mismatched duo tries to survive the merciless American Frontier.

The film is penned by Souza who also storied the pic Baldwin, who is also producing the film via his El Dorado banner. Also producing are Matt DelPiano of Cavalry Media, Ryan Donnell Smith of Thomasville Pictures, Anjul Nigam of Brittany House Pictures and Ryan Winterstern and Nathan Klingher of Short Porch Pictures. Allen Cheney, Emily Hunter Salveson as well as Christopher M.B. Sharp and Jennifer E. Lamb are exec producers, with Hunter Salveson and Donnell Smith’s Streamline Global on board for financing.
